Renfrewshire Council has tested a new approach to tackling potholes on roads in Paisley , Johnstone and a number of other areas during the summer.
The local authority worked with a company called Velocity to pilot a technique known as jet patching throughout the course of last month.
The method, which is also referred to as spray injection patching, repairs potholes and damaged road surfaces using a specialised machine.
An update was provided on the trial in a report to the infrastructure, land and environment policy board on Wednesday.
